This 9,204-square-foot apartment building contains 29 rooms arranged in double-room, single-room, and suite configurations. The layouts include shared and private bathrooms, with suites also offering space for a microwave and refrigerator. Interior features include high ceilings, a kitchen island, storage areas, a laundry room, and a large first-floor kitchen and dining hall. The building is constructed of brick and includes forced-air heating, central air, fireplaces, a slate roof, and public water and sewer service.

A private courtyard provides outdoor common space, while driveway parking serves the property. The building was constructed in 1953 and has previously accommodated convent, dormitory, and shared-living uses. It is currently vacant and includes additional basement storage and first-floor shared areas.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.
